The imperial system is defined as the measurement system used in countries like the UK, Liberia, Myanmar, etc. that uses units like an inch, pound, ton, etc. The metric system is defined as the decimal system of units based on the meters, kilograms, and second as the units of length, mass, and time respectively.

    Do British people use imperial units?Some British people still use one or more imperial units in everyday life for distance (miles, yards, feet, and inches) and some types of volume measurement (especially milk and beer in pints; rarely for canned or bottled soft drinks, or petrol ).
